We visited the last week of September '02, and it rained the first four days of our trip. And when I say it rained, I mean it RAINED. It is hurricane season (Isabel, duh!), and sure enough a couple days before we arrived one had swept into the gulf--sorry don't remember the name. By the time we hit Orlando, the storm system had moved east and right into town with us.
We had rain at least a half-day for those four days straight.
Best advice--be prepared for it. Bring ponchos and umbrellas. Make sure everyone in your party is prepared for the rain so that tempers don't flare. Think about things you can do indoors if you just can't take anymore rain. Find out where the laundry facilties are in your resort (assuming you aren't staying in a home away from home).
On the brighter side, rain has a tendency to empty out the parks. If you can weather the storm (literally!), you may be nicely rewarded if the rain lets up after a short period. One of our fondest memories from last fall was a nearly empty Tapestry of Dreams parade at which our son got unlimited attention from the performers because there was hardly anyone at Epcot.
Hope for the best, but prepare for the worst. At least you won't be caught off-guard.
